Diagnosis
This loud grinding or buzzing noise in the Frigidaire EFIC189 is almost always caused by a mechanical obstruction within the ice-harvesting assembly. Specifically, the auger—the spiral screw responsible for pushing the nugget ice from the freezing cylinder into the storage bin—is encountering resistance. When the motor attempts to rotate the auger but cannot move it freely, the motor strains, creating a high-pitched buzzing or a harsh grinding sound as the gears struggle to overcome the blockage. The root cause is typically one of two things: "ice bridging" or a foreign object. Ice bridging occurs when moisture leaks into the chute or the unit is operated in a room that is too warm, causing the nugget ice to melt slightly and then refreeze into a solid block. This block locks the auger in place. Alternatively, a piece of plastic packaging or a stray mineral deposit from hard water can wedge between the auger blade and the cylinder wall. You can confirm this by listening closely to the noise; if the buzzing is rhythmic and coincides with the ice-drop cycle, it is a mechanical jam. If the noise is constant and coming from the bottom, it may be the compressor, but a "grinding" sound is almost exclusively related to the auger system.
How to Fix It
Follow these steps to clear the obstruction and reset the harvesting mechanism:
- Immediately unplug the EFIC189 from the wall outlet to prevent the motor from burning out due to the torque strain.
- Remove the ice basket entirely. Use a high-lumen LED flashlight to inspect the ice chute and the area where the ice drops.
- Check for "ice bridges"—solid chunks of ice that have fused to the sides of the chute. If you see a block, do not use a metal screwdriver or knife to chip it away, as you can puncture the evaporator wall. Instead, pour room-temperature (not boiling) filtered water over the ice block to melt the bond.
- Inspect the auger blades. If a foreign object is visible, use a pair of long-reach needle-nose pliers to gently extract it.
- Perform a "Hard Reset" of the ice cycle: With the machine unplugged, wait 30 minutes for any internal frost to soften.
- Plug the unit back in and press the "Reset" button on the back or side of the unit (if applicable to your specific revision) or simply power it on.
- Listen for the first cycle. If the grinding persists, immediately power off and proceed to the alternative solutions.
If That Didn't Work
- Deep Defrost Cycle: Unplug the unit and leave the lid open for 24 full hours. This ensures that any ice buildup behind the cylinder—where you cannot see or reach—is completely melted. Often, a "hidden" ice jam occurs behind the auger housing that requires a full thaw to resolve.
- Scale Removal: If you have hard water, calcium deposits can build up on the auger shaft, causing it to grind against the housing. Mix a solution of 50% white vinegar and 50% distilled water. Run this through the reservoir and run several cycles. This dissolves the mineral crust that creates the friction.
- Motor Gear Inspection: If the noise is a metallic "clicking" or "grinding" without any ice blockage, the internal plastic gears of the auger motor may have stripped. This requires a teardown of the chassis to inspect the gear assembly. If the gears are stripped, the motor assembly must be replaced as a single unit.
- Air Vent Clearance: Ensure there is at least 6 inches of clearance around the side vents. If the unit overheats, the lubricant in the auger bearings can thin out, leading to increased mechanical noise and friction.
Heads Up
- Avoid Metal Tools: Never use metal picks or screwdrivers to clear ice from the freezing cylinder; the aluminum walls are thin and easily punctured, which will ruin the refrigerant seal and kill the machine.
- Water Quality: Always use filtered water. Using tap water with high mineral content leads to scale buildup on the auger, which is the primary cause of the grinding noise over time.
- Siting: Keep the unit away from heat sources like ovens or direct sunlight. Excessive ambient heat causes the ice to melt and refreeze in the chute, creating the very "bridges" that cause the motor to jam.
- Regular Cleaning: Run a cleaning cycle with the provided cleaning tablet or a mild citric acid solution every 30 days to prevent mineral friction on the moving parts.
